Overview Aqua Gold 1% Eye Drop
Dry eye relief is provided by Aqua Gold 1% lubricating eye drops, acting as artificial tears. Insufficient tear production leading to dry eye discomfort is addressed by this product. It soothes burning and irritation by restoring proper eye moisture. Aqua Gold 1% is used as needed; the prescribed dosage should be followed. Allow at least 5-10 minutes between administering this and other eye medications to prevent weakening. Discard any bottle with a damaged seal. Always wash hands and avoid touching the dropper tip to prevent infection. Long-term use is safe and may be necessary. Common, typically temporary, side effects include blurry vision, redness, irritation, or eye pain. Report these to your physician. Refrain from driving, operating machinery, or activities requiring clear vision until vision is restored. If your condition worsens or side effects persist, consult your doctor. While generally unaffected by other medications, inform your physician of any history of glaucoma. Avoid use while wearing soft contact lenses, and contact your doctor if an eye infection develops.

How to use Aqua Gold 1% Eye Drop:
Apply this medication externally only. Administer as directed by your physician regarding dosage and treatment length. Always consult the product label for application instructions. Position the dropper near the eye, avoiding contact. Carefully dispense the medication into the lower conjunctival sac. Remove any excess solution.
How Aqua Gold 1% Eye Drop works:
Gold Aqua 1% ophthalmic solution is an artificial tear substitute. It mimics the properties of natural tears, offering short-term alleviation of burning and irritation caused by dry eyes.
